SHINee’s Taemin gets transferred to public service in the military due to worsening mental health
K-pop group SHINee’s member Taemin who was initially enlisted in the military band as a part of his mandatory army service, will now be completing the rest of his duration as a public service worker. The sudden change has been put in place keeping his mental health in mind after worsening symptoms of his depression and anxiety.
Confirming the same, SHINee’s agency SM Entertainment released a fresh statement on the same.
Quoted by several Korean media outlets, it read, “This is SM Entertainment. As of January 14, Taemin has been transferred from the military band to supplementary service.”
“Due to the symptoms of depression and anxiety that Taemin has been suffering from before [his enlistment], he continued to receive treatment and therapy even while carrying out his service. However, because his symptoms recently worsened, the military determined that it had become impossible for him to continue his military life and treatment at the same time, and he was accordingly transferred to supplementary service” it added.
“Therefore, Taemin plans to fulfill his military duty as a public service worker. We apologize for giving you cause for concern through this sudden news, and we will continue to focus on Taemin’s treatment in the future and do our utmost to ensure that he can find stability” it concluded.
Last year, in May, Taemin enlisted in the military after receiving basic training.
